Unfortunately, I can't speak to the regulations in India... However, in the US - 21CFR184.1240 states that carbon dioxide is generally recognized as safe as a direct food additive based upon good manufacturing conditions of use listed at the link (one of which being that the ingredient is of a purity suitable for intended use).
I would imagine that this extends to the realm of juices, assuming all other pertinent regs are followed?
